Output 07f8fa938f4c0f9da3671285280e5f569f2040c53d7cd5ea32193f433f612143:28

value
129561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 829b97d4c5a6b173c9baffa82f7feff2d87b1528 OP_EQUAL
address
3DbcAH9L972kNVkYn8wCyZPCt6J2nr7MNY
transaction
07f8fa938f4c0f9da3671285280e5f569f2040c53d7cd5ea32193f433f612143
confirmations
154847
spent
true